Especificaciones

Series MAX® 10
Part Status Active
DigiKey Programmable Not Verified
Number of LABs/CLBs 500
Number of Logic Elements/Cells 8000
Total RAM Bits 387072
Number of I/O 246
Voltage - Supply 1.15V ~ 1.25V
Mounting Type Surface Mount
Operating Temperature 0°C ~ 85°C (TJ)
Package 324-LFBGA
Supplier Device Package 324-UBGA (15x15)
Packaging Tray
